Наша организация использует Skype для бизнеса таким образом, чтобы ссылки на собрания имели следующую форму

https://lync.co.<tld-of-company>/meet/<user-id>/<identifier>

При нажатии на эту ссылку отображается страница, в которой меня спрашивают, с каким клиентом я хочу присоединиться к конференции: «Skype Meetings App (Интернет)» или «Skype для бизнеса (ПК)».

Страница выбора Skype для бизнеса клиента

Этот диалог раздражает, потому что я всегда хочу присоединиться к настольному клиенту. Есть ли способ настроить это?

1 ответ1

0

Мне удалось автоматически открыть клиент рабочего стола с помощью следующего скрипта Greasemonkey:

// ==UserScript==
// @name     Auto-redirect to Skype for Business desktop client
// @version  1
// @grant    none
// @include  https://lync.co.<your-domain-here>/*
// ==/UserScript==

window.onload = function() {
  var matches = window.location.href.match(/^https:\/\/[^/]*\/meet\/([^/]*)\/([^/?]*)/);
  if (matches) {
    var emailDomain = "@<your-domain-here>"
    var target = "conf:sip:" + matches[1] + emailDomain + ";gruu;opaque=app:conf:focus:id:" + matches[2] + "%3Frequired-media=audio"
    console.log("Redirecting to " + target)
    window.location = target
  }
}

Он вычисляет URI conf: из URL-адреса выбора клиента и открывает его.

Обратите внимание, что два вхождения <your-domain-here> необходимо заменить соответствующими корпоративными доменами.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.